What is Rinvoq?
Rinvoq is a prescription medication that belongs to a class of drugs called Janus kinase (JAK) inhibitors. It is primarily used to treat moderate to severe rheumatoid arthritis in adults who have not responded well to other treatments. Rinvoq works by blocking specific enzymes in the body that contribute to inflammation.

Symptoms of Acne with Rinvoq
If you are concerned about the possibility of developing acne while taking Rinvoq, it is important to be aware of the common symptoms. These may include:
-
Pimples : Small, raised bumps on the skin that may be red or inflamed.
-
Blackheads : Open comedones that appear as dark spots on the skin.
-
Whiteheads : Closed comedones that appear as small, white bumps on the skin.
-
Cysts : Large, painful, pus-filled bumps that can cause scarring.
